The co-operation of individual point vortices has been investigated thoroughly in flow 



dyamics. Without any outside manipulation an individual vortex rotates on the spot. 

That changes in the case of two neighbouring vortices. Now it depends on their mutual 

strength and sense of rotation. If they have the opposite sense of rotation and equal 

strength then their centres of rotation move straight forward in the same direction. If 

however the direction of rotation is the same then both vortices rotate around each other 

(fig. 4.9).

 

In this way a multitude of point vortices is capable, to form in the first case whole vortex 



streets and in the second case spherical vortex balls. In principle a vortex string can also 

consist of a multitude of potential vortices pointing in the same direction; but it has the 

tendency to roll up to a vortex ball in case it is disturbed from the outside, as can be shown

 

very clear by means of computer simulations
